							Lincoln: Gertrude Munsch, 97, of Lincoln passed away 
							at 2:45 A.M. Wednesday, April 30, 2014 at the 
							Christian Village Nursing Home in Lincoln.  
							Gertrude was born on October 5, 1916 in Logan 
							County, IL to Marion and Sue Primm Sparks. She 
							married Henry W. Franz on November 27, 1936. He 
							preceded her in death on December 31, 1970. She 
							later married Wayne V. Munsch on December 6, 1980. 
							He preceded her in death on October 16, 2012.  
							She is survived by her daughter, Janet (Marvin) 
							Johnson of Lincoln, daughter-in-law, Linda Franz of 
							Lincoln; grandchildren, Aaron (Debbie) and Ryan 
							(Becky) Johnson, Amy (John) Tabor, Delyn (Brian) 
							Duggins and Tyler Franz; brother, Marion J. Sparks, 
							of Denver, CO; nine great-grandchildren; and step 
							children, Doris Anderson, Ruby Allen, Clarence 
							Munsch and Harry Munsch. | 
                    
					 
							She was preceded in death by her parents, two 
							husbands, son Dwain Franz, sister Margaret Wilmert 
							and two brothers, Wayne and Russell Sparks. 
							Gertrude was associated with the Logan County ASCS 
							for over 20 years as a program assistant and on the 
							county committee. She was a member of the St. John 
							United Church of Christ, past matron of the Lincoln 
							Chapter #351 Order of the Eastern Star, Abraham 
							Lincoln Chapter of the Daughters of the American 
							Revolution, Home Extension and various church 
							organizations.
